When an accident on an oil rig results in an environmental catastrophe, it surely takes a particular genius to turn the oil company involved into the victim. Yet, remarkably, that is precisely what ... Barack Obama appears to have achieved. When, after many weeks, BP still hadn’t managed to prevent its damaged well from spewing tens of thousands of gallons of oil into the Gulf of Mexico, Obama turned upon it savagely, saying he would like to sack its chief executive and threatening the company with unlimited financial punishments.
